Liability in information security can take many forms. Understanding these different types helps professionals recognize their legal obligations and potential risks.
Civil Liability is the most common form in cybersecurity cases. It involves claims for damages resulting from negligence, breach of contract, or failure to meet industry standards. For example, if a company’s inadequate security measures lead to a data breach, affected parties may sue for financial losses or harm caused by the exposure of their data.
Criminal Liability occurs when actions violate laws that prohibit certain behaviors, such as hacking, data theft, or unauthorized access. Cybersecurity professionals must ensure that their practices comply with criminal statutes to avoid legal prosecution.
Vicarious Liability holds an organization responsible for the actions of its employees or agents. This means that if an employee’s negligence causes a security incident, the organization may be legally liable. This emphasizes the importance of comprehensive security policies and employee training.
Professional Liability relates specifically to individuals in specialized roles, such as CISSP-certified professionals. It arises from the obligation to perform duties with a standard of care and competence. Failure to meet these standards can lead to lawsuits, loss of certification, or professional sanctions.
Several legal principles are essential to understanding liability in the information security domain.
Negligence is a key concept that involves the failure to exercise reasonable care to prevent harm. In cybersecurity, negligence might be demonstrated if a professional fails to patch known vulnerabilities or ignores security protocols, leading to a breach.
Due Diligence refers to the effort made to avoid harm by investigating risks and implementing appropriate safeguards. Security professionals show due diligence by conducting risk assessments, monitoring systems, and ensuring compliance with laws and standards.
Due Care involves ongoing actions to maintain security and minimize risks. This includes enforcing policies, conducting regular audits, and responding promptly to security incidents. Failing to apply due care can increase liability exposure.
In legal terms, demonstrating due diligence and due care can serve as a defense against negligence claims. Organizations and individuals who can show they took reasonable steps to secure systems are less likely to be found liable.

Negligence is a leading cause of liability in cybersecurity. When a security professional or organization fails to exercise due care, resulting in harm or loss, they may be held legally responsible.
Courts often evaluate negligence claims based on whether a duty of care existed, whether that duty was breached, and whether the breach directly caused damages. In cybersecurity cases, evidence may include failure to implement security measures, inadequate training of staff, or poor incident response.
One example of negligence leading to liability is when an organization ignores warnings about security weaknesses and fails to act. If this leads to a breach exposing customer data, the organization may face lawsuits, regulatory penalties, and class-action suits.

One of the most influential regulations globally is the European Union’s General Data Protection Regulation (GDPR). Although it is an EU law, GDPR impacts any organization worldwide that processes the personal data of EU residents.
GDPR imposes strict requirements on data collection, processing, storage, and transfer, emphasizing data subject rights and privacy by design. Organizations must implement appropriate technical and organizational measures to ensure data security and privacy.
Failure to comply with GDPR can lead to hefty fines—up to 4% of global annual turnover or €20 million, whichever is greater. Liability may also arise from civil suits by affected individuals, regulatory investigations, and reputational harm.
In the United States, the Health Insurance Portability and Accountability Act (HIPAA) governs the protection of sensitive patient health information. Covered entities, such as healthcare providers and insurers, must ensure the confidentiality, integrity, and availability of protected health information (PHI).
HIPAA’s Security Rule mandates administrative, physical, and technical safeguards, including access controls, encryption, and audit trails. Breaches of PHI can lead to civil and criminal penalties, especially if due care was not exercised.
HIPAA liability extends not only to covered entities but also to their business associates, who handle PHI on their behalf. Compliance programs and risk assessments are critical for avoiding liability under HIPAA.
The Payment Card Industry Data Security Standard (PCI DSS) applies to organizations that handle credit card transactions. Although PCI DSS is a standard rather than a law, compliance is enforced through contracts with payment processors and acquiring banks.
Failure to comply with PCI DSS can result in fines, increased transaction fees, and liability for fraud losses. Moreover, PCI DSS compliance is often considered a benchmark for demonstrating due care in securing payment data.
Security professionals must ensure that controls related to network security, access management, and monitoring meet PCI DSS requirements to mitigate liability associated with payment data breaches.
The Sarbanes-Oxley Act (SOX) primarily targets financial reporting and corporate governance but has important implications for cybersecurity liability. SOX mandates that organizations maintain accurate financial records and implement internal controls to prevent fraud.
Cybersecurity measures protecting financial data and systems fall within SOX compliance requirements. Security breaches that compromise financial data integrity can expose organizations and executives to liability.
Effective risk management, audit trails, and access controls are essential components of SOX compliance from a cybersecurity perspective.
The Federal Information Security Management Act (FISMA) requires federal agencies and contractors to develop, document, and implement information security programs. FISMA emphasizes risk-based approaches and continuous monitoring to protect government information systems.
Liability under FISMA arises when agencies or contractors fail to comply with prescribed security standards, resulting in breaches or data loss. FISMA compliance frameworks, such as NIST SP 800-53, guide cybersecurity controls and risk assessments.
Security professionals working in or with federal environments must be conversant with FISMA requirements to manage liability effectively.

Artificial intelligence (AI) and machine learning technologies are increasingly integrated into cybersecurity defenses, automating threat detection and response. While AI offers significant benefits, it also introduces complex liability questions.
Who is liable if an AI system fails to detect a breach or erroneously blocks legitimate activity? As AI systems make autonomous decisions, traditional liability frameworks based on human actions face challenges.
Organizations must ensure AI algorithms are transparent, tested, and audited regularly to avoid negligence claims. Cybersecurity professionals should be aware of emerging regulations focused on AI ethics and accountability to minimize legal exposure.

Cyber insurance has emerged as a critical tool for managing liability exposure. Policies often cover costs related to breach response, regulatory fines, and legal defense.
However, insurers increasingly require organizations to meet certain cybersecurity standards to qualify for coverage. Poor security practices or non-compliance can result in denied claims.
Understanding the terms, exclusions, and obligations of cyber insurance policies is essential for comprehensive liability management. Cybersecurity professionals should work closely with legal and risk teams to align security programs with insurance requirements.

New legal theories are developing to address the unique aspects of cybersecurity risks. Concepts like strict liability for critical infrastructure operators and expanded fiduciary duties for executives are gaining traction.
Some jurisdictions are exploring liability for failure to implement minimum cybersecurity standards, shifting the focus from negligence to mandatory compliance.
Staying abreast of these evolving theories helps professionals anticipate legal risks and advocate for appropriate security investments.
